A thrilling opportunity has arisen for a bright German speaker to join an international organisation in Watford. In this new role, you will be responsible for coordinating your allocated customer accounts and promoting client retention. Your responsibilities will include: Administrating and coordinating existing customer accounts from A to Z Being the first point of contact for your assigned clients, communicating with them via phone and email to answer questions, give them company updates and follow up on their contracts Coordinating with other departments to deliver customer requirements Ensuring all client account records are kept up to dateAbout you: The ideal candidate will be confident with strong language skills and will possess outstanding communication skills, as you will be communicating with various clients and departments within the company. Profile: Required to be fluent in German written and spoken Previous experience working in customer care, administration, client support or account management dealing with products Solid knowledge of Microsoft operating systems Demonstrated interpersonal skills and the ability to work as part of a team and independentlyTo apply, please send your CV in English and in Word format to Ismael. languagematters is acting as an employment agency in relation to this vacancy

How to prepare for a job interview at Language Matters Recruitment Consultants Ltd

✨Showcase Your Language Skills

Since the role requires fluency in German, be prepared to demonstrate your language proficiency during the interview. You might be asked to answer questions or discuss your experience in German, so practice speaking and writing in the language beforehand.

✨Highlight Relevant Experience

Make sure to discuss any previous roles in customer care, administration, or account management. Provide specific examples of how you successfully managed client accounts or resolved issues, as this will show your capability for the position.

✨Prepare for Interdepartmental Coordination

The job involves working with various departments, so be ready to discuss how you've effectively collaborated with others in past roles. Think of examples where teamwork led to successful outcomes, and be prepared to explain your approach to communication.

✨Demonstrate Your Communication Skills

As the first point of contact for clients, strong communication is key. Practice articulating your thoughts clearly and confidently. Consider preparing a few questions to ask the interviewer about the company’s communication style and client interaction strategies.
